Daikyonishikawa completes share cancellation, reducing outstanding stock
Daikyonishikawa Corporation announced on September 30, 2025, the completion of its own share cancellation, as resolved by the board of directors on September 22, 2025. This action, taken under Article 178 of the Companies Act of Japan, involved cancelling 2,898,600 common shares.
These cancelled shares represented 3.9% of the total issued shares prior to the cancellation. Following this strategic move, the total number of issued shares for Daikyonishikawa Corporation now stands at 70,997,800. The announcement was made by Ikuo Sugiyama, representative director and president, and communicated by Hironori Matsuo, managing executive officer.
